In October 2009, I was asked by the late and much-missed Bryce Conrad, when the journal was still published at his university, Texas Tech, if I would take over from him as editor. The circumstances of his approach were very sad as he wished to step away from his responsibilities due to the terminal illness he had been diagnosed with and so devote his remaining years to being with his family. He died in 2017. Bryce was a gentleman, an inspiration, and a friendly guide as I sought to learn the ropes from him, and that moment when he asked me in person to be the one to take on the editorship remains the proudest of my academic career. I am very happy to have managed to guide the journal for the subsequent 16 years, and I hope I have lived up to the faith Bryce showed in me.I do wish now, however, to make this my last issue as editor and hand over to someone I completely trust to improve the journal and add fresh impetus to it. To this end I was very pleased when Mark Long expressed his interest in taking over when I voiced my wish to him. Mark is well-known to the Williams scholarly community, having served as the Williams Society president and been an enthusiastic and dedicated friend to any who have worked with him. The journal is thus in good hands, and I know he will have the support of the journal’s board and its readers.
